Thomas J. Churchill, a writer, producer, director, actor and radio host, is the founder and CEO of Church Hill Productions, and most recently lent his talents to authoring, producing and directing "Check Point". "Check Point" stars William Forsythe, Kane Hodder and Fred Williamson, and will be released to theaters across the country in Spring 2016. Churchill played Roger Takahara in Gregory Hatanaka's "Samurai Cop 2: Deadly Vengeance from Cinema Epoch. Churchill has an upcoming slate of films that he will be producing and directing, including "Nation's Fire", "Marilyn: Zombie Hunter", "Blood and Iron" and "Beautiful Nightmare".
Dawna Lee Heising and Renah Wolzinger covered Norby Walter's annual Oscar party "Night of 100 Stars" at the Beverly Hilton Hotel for the television series Eye on Entertainment on Time Warner Cable. Night of 100 Stars is one of the most exclusive, high-profile awards night events of the year and has been hosted for 16 years by Norby Walters.
Dawna Lee Heising interviewed multi-talented Krista Grotte for Eye on Entertainment. Krista is an award winning actress, internationally published fitness model, aviation technology expert and star of Thomas J. Churchill's films "Emerging Past", "Check Point" and "Nation's Fire". Krista's roles in horror films include The Godfather of Gore Herschell Gordon Lewis' film "The Uh-Oh Show", "Death On Demand", "Filthy", "Lazarus: Apocalypse" and "Emerging Past". Her lead role in Thomas J. Churchill's "Emerging Past" sold out three theaters at the New York City International Film Festival, earning the honor of Best Horror Feature. EP also earned her a Best Actress Award through the Full Moon Horror Festival in Nashville, TN.
Claudia Coloma, Dawna Lee Heising, Enrique Almeida, Steven Marter, Trace Schroeder, and Steve Lentz shot a promo for Chandra Gerson's three short films - "Burning Distortion", "A Gracious War", and "Salvation of One" - that will be screening at the 2016 Cannes Marche Du Film. Phil Gibson was Cinematographer, Lighting Director and Editor, and Kevin Johnson handled Sound.
Dawna Lee Heising of Eye on Entertainment interviewed Bobby Easley and Dustin Kay of Horror Wasteland Pictures at the Days of the Dead event in Burbank, CA on April 3, 2016. Easley and Kay were in town to promote their films "The Devil Dogs of Kilo Company", "All Sinners Night" and "Belly Timber". Segment was shot and edited by John Cox of Polymedia Entertainment.
Eye on Entertainment is an award-winning television show that features interviews with successful entertainment visionaries, exploring the traits they have in common, with a unique focus on independent film and television.
